个人电脑搭建linux服务器

搭建一个个人Linux VPS(Virtual Private Server)可以为你提供独立的服务器环境,让你能够自由搭建一个个人Linux VPS(Virtual Private Server)可以为你提供独立的服务器环境,让你能够自由地运行和管理你的应用程序和网站,下面是一个简单的技术教程,帮助你在个人Linux电脑上搭建VPS。

1. 准备工作:

个人电脑搭建linux服务器

- 一台个人Linux电脑,推荐使用Ubuntu或Debian操作系统。

- 一个静态IP地址或者域名。

- SSH(Secure Shell)客户端,用于远程连接和管理服务器。

2. 安装VPS服务器软件:

- 打开终端,更新系统软件包列表:

     sudo apt update
     

- 安装VPS服务器软件,这里以Ubuntu为例,使用`Ubuntu Server`镜像:

     sudo apt install ubuntu-server
     

- 选择安装时的语言和其他设置,然后按照提示完成安装过程。

个人电脑搭建linux服务器

3. 配置网络:

- 编辑网络配置文件:

     sudo nano /etc/netplan/00-installer-config.yaml
     

- 将文件中的内容修改为以下内容(假设你的静态IP地址是192.168.1.100):

     network:
       version: 2
       renderer: networkd
       ethernets:
         enp0s3:
           dhcp4: no
           addresses: [192.168.1.100/24]
           gateway4: 192.168.1.1
           nameservers:
             addresses: [8.8.8.8, 8.8.4.4]
     

- 保存文件并退出编辑器。

- 应用网络配置:

     sudo netplan apply
     

4. 设置SSH远程访问:

- 生成SSH密钥对:

个人电脑搭建linux服务器

     sudo apt install openssh-server
     sudo systemctl enable ssh --now
     sudo ufw allow ssh
     

- 获取公钥:

     ls -la ~/.ssh/id_rsa.pub
     

- 将公钥复制到服务器的`authorized_keys`文件中:

     ssh-copy-id your_username@your_server_ip_address_or_domain_name
     

- 现在你可以使用SSH客户端连接到你的VPS服务器了。

5. 管理你的VPS:

- 你可以使用任何SSH客户端连接到你的VPS服务器,例如PuTTY、Termius等,输入你的用户名和密码进行登录。

- 现在你可以在你的VPS上运行和管理你的应用程序和网站了,你可以安装和配置所需的软件和服务,例如Nginx、MySQL等。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/76640.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-04 09:12
Next 2023-12-04 09:12

相关推荐

  • vps搭建用不了怎么解决

    当VPS搭建无法使用时,可以通过删除实例后重新创建来解决问题。注意定时检查是否有可疑账号和系统日志,发现可疑文件和进程可以使用360安全卫士进行检查。也需注意网站文件夹的权限设置,防止由于VPS被入侵导致资料被删除。尽量避免手动修改注册表,以免VPS启动不了。

    2024-02-13
    0101
  • 如何注册基础版节点在Linux系统上作为零基础用户?

    注册基础版节点在Linux系统上,首先需要确保系统满足最低硬件和软件要求。通过命令行或图形界面创建用户账户,配置网络和安全设置,安装必要的软件包,最后启动并运行节点服务。

    2024-08-09
    039
  • linux服务器怎么打开浏览器文件夹管理功能

    在Linux服务器上,我们通常使用命令行界面进行操作,而不是像在Windows或Mac上那样直接打开浏览器来管理文件,有一些工具可以帮助我们在Linux服务器上实现类似浏览器的文件管理功能,本文将介绍如何在Linux服务器上使用这些工具来打开文件夹并进行管理。我们需要了解的是,Linux服务器上的文件系统是树状结构的,每个目录(文件夹……

    2023-11-12
    0176
  • Linux服务器入门:服务器根目录详解 (服务器根目录是root)

    Linux服务器入门:服务器根目录详解 (服务器根目录是root)在Linux系统中,每个文件和目录都有其特定的位置,这些位置通过一个称为“路径”的概念来表示,在Linux中,路径是从根目录开始的,它是所有其他目录和文件的起始点,本文将详细介绍Linux服务器的根目录及其相关概念。1、什么是根目录?根目录是Linux文件系统的起点,位……

    2024-02-27
    097
  • 如何安全关闭Linux系统中的iptables防火墙?

    要在Linux中关闭iptables防火墙,可以执行以下命令:,,1. 停止iptables服务:,``,sudo systemctl stop iptables,`,,2. 禁用iptables服务,使其在系统启动时不会自动运行:,`,sudo systemctl disable iptables,``,,执行这些操作需要root权限。

    2024-08-02
    076
  • 为何Linux系统中的对象名称要以$符号开头?

    在Linux系统中,以$开头的对象名称通常表示环境变量。$PATH是一个环境变量,它包含了系统搜索可执行程序的路径。你可以在命令行中使用echo $PATH来查看它的值。

    2024-08-06
    073

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入